The flooring available as 3/4" Solid Robinia Teak Hand Scraped
Mocha 5" is one of the more rustic styles of flooring made from
solid wood. As a species, teak is one of the harder woods, which is
why it is often used to create hardwood flooring. This wood also
has a knotty grain, which enhances the rustic or country appearance
of the flooring. The natural burls or knots are randomly spaced
within the grain of the wood, which creates an interesting visual
pattern for the entire floor. This particular flooring measures 5
inches in width and is ¾ inches thick. The length of this flooring
is random and the color ranges from deep hues of mocha brown to
light shades of beige. The extreme variation of colors also
enhances the overall rustic appeal of this floor, which is why it
is frequently used in country kitchens, bedrooms and family rooms.
